In a lean manufacturing system, in order to reduce the inventory of finished products (or work-in-process, WIP), pull production and just-in-time (JIT) are two important techniques. Pull production is to pull a job from an upstream workstation for processing only when a downstream workstation is about to become idle [ … WebPush system. work is pushed to the next station as it is completed and manufacturing quantities are planned in anticipation (in advance) of actual demand. Pull system (JIT) a workstation pulls output from the preceding workstation as it is needed; output of the final operation is pulled by customer demand or the master schedule. JIT (Pull)
